BLS metro-level wage data places Cost Estimators pay in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area at a median of $86,250 per year ($41.47/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$78,740,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area pays +10% above, signaling either concentrated employer demand, a cost-of-living premium, or both. Approximately 50 cost estimatorss are employed across the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area MSA in SOC 13-1051.
The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area pay distribution spans from $51,390 at the 10th percentile to $119,990 at the 90th — a 2.3×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$59,930 and the 75th at $103,670, so half of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area-based cost estimatorss earn within that middle band.

BLS draws metro boundaries from the OMB MSA definitions, so Eastern Oregon nonmetropolitan area covers the central city plus outlying counties tied to the metro economically. Remember that OEWS wages reflect base pay only: employer-provided health insurance, retirement matches, stock options, signing bonuses, overtime, and tips are excluded and can add 20-40% to real total compensation.
